Real Estate Transfer Tax Reform Postponed

25 October 2019 – The amendments to the Real Estate Transfer Tax Act are not going into effect on the 1 January 2020 as proposed

The RETT amendments proposed are being discussed further in the German Parliament and may be changed. The Parliament says it is working at full speed to finish the reform of the law in the first half of 2020 as they have recently announced.  It is uncertain whether any substantial changes will be made to the present draft bill. There are rumors that the thresholds and the underlying system may again be called into question.
